Potential Consequences of Abandonment in Preschool-Age: Neuropsychological Findings in Institutionalized Children
Objective: Several longitudinal studies had shown that early deprivation and institutionalization during the first six months of life affects the emotional, cognitive, social and neurophysiologic development.
